原文:JavaScript ES6 Arrow Functions(箭頭函數)

. 介紹 第一眼看到ES 新增加的arrow function 時,感覺非常像lambda 表達式。 那么arrow function是干什么的呢 可以看作為匿名函數的簡寫方式。 如: var addition function a, b return a b 等同 var addition a, b gt return a b . 語法 arrow functions 箭頭函數 主要有以下 種 ...

2018-01-26 10:26 0 1402 推薦指數:

查看詳情

ES6箭頭函數Arrow Functions

ES6可以使用“箭頭”(=>)定義函數,注意是函數,不要使用這種方式定義類(構造器)。 一、語法 1. 具有一個參數的簡單函數 var single = a => a single('hello, world') // 'hello, world ...

Thu Apr 09 02:00:00 CST 2015 5 55831
JS ES6中的箭頭函數Arrow Functions)使用

ES6可以使用“箭頭”(=>)定義函數,注意是函數,不要使用這種方式定義類(構造器)。 一、語法 基礎語法 (參數1, 參數2, …, 參數N) => { 函數聲明 } (參數1, 參數2, …, 參數N) => 表達式(單一) //相當於:(參數1, 參數 ...

Thu Mar 21 19:13:00 CST 2019 0 1080
JS ES6中的箭頭函數Arrow Functions)使用

轉載這篇ES6箭頭函數方便自己查閱。 ES6可以使用“箭頭”(=>)定義函數,注意是函數,不要使用這種方式定義類(構造器)。 一、語法 基礎語法 高級語法 實例 1. 具有一個參數的簡單函數 2. 沒有參數的需要用在箭頭前加上小括號 ...

Fri Nov 24 02:06:00 CST 2017 1 8442
javascript es6 匿名函數(arrow function)

arrow function 不會自帶this變量 arrow function 沒有arguments變量 arrow function 有點像c#中的匿名函數 https://developer.mozilla.org/en/docs/Web/JavaScript/Reference ...

Sat Jan 09 00:16:00 CST 2016 0 1774
es6 箭頭函數(arrow function) 學習筆記

箭頭函數有兩個好處。☕ 1.他們比傳統函數表達式簡潔。 2.箭頭函數不會綁定關鍵字this,我們不需要用bind()或者that = this這種方法了 和this同樣沒有被箭頭函數綁定的參數有 arguments super ...

Sun Mar 26 20:18:00 CST 2017 0 1517
es6箭頭函數

箭頭函數用 => 符號來定義。 箭頭函數相當於匿名函數,所以采用函數表達式的寫法。 左邊是傳入函數的參數,右邊是函數中執行的語句。 相當於 上面是完整的寫法,左邊小括號,右邊大括號,而下面的情況可以簡寫: (1)當要執行的代碼塊只有一條return語句時,可省略 ...

Thu Apr 18 21:51:00 CST 2019 1 3829
ES6 箭頭(=>)函數

一、語法 1. 具有一個參數的簡單函數 2. 沒有參數的需要用在箭頭前加上小括號 3. 多個參數需要用到小括號,參數間逗號間隔,例如兩個數字相加 4. 函數體多條語句需要用到大括號 5. 返回對象時需要用小括號包起來,因為大括號被占 ...

Fri Nov 09 18:50:00 CST 2018 0 958
JavaScript ES6 箭頭函數 匿名函數 普通函數

箭頭函數 箭頭函數ES6的新特性,簡化了函數的寫法 普通函數 this指向調用者 具有prototype this指向可以被call/apply/bind改變 普通函數的this在運行時創建,箭頭函數的this是聲明時確定 匿名函數 表現為function后面不帶名字的函數,但是可以用 ...

Mon Jul 13 05:14:00 CST 2020 0 730
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M